Brief Description
The Miles Morland Foundation African Writers' Scholarship is awarded to a Postgraduate student within the School of Literature, Drama and Creative Writing to enable them to study on the MA Creative Writing (Prose Fiction) course.
Eligibility
Level: Postgraduate
Fees: International
School: Literature, Drama and Creative Writing
Course: MA Creative Writing (Prose
Fiction) or MA Biography and Creative Non-Fiction
Country of Birth: Any country within Africa or
Nationality: Any country within Africa or
Other Criteria: Both parents born in Africa (If the scholarship is awarded on this basis, copies of both parents' passports must be provided as evidence to UEA at point of acceptance of the scholarship.)
Deadline is May 1
